How the US military could clear mines from the Strait of Hormuz

TELEMETRY SUMMARY DECRYPTION

SITREP: The US military is considering the deployment of drones, explosive-laden robots, and helicopters to clear mines from the Strait of Hormuz. Despite these technological advancements, de-mining crews may remain at risk from potential Iranian attacks. TACTICAL ASSESSMENT: The use of advanced technology for mine clearance indicates a strategic shift towards minimizing personnel risk in high-threat environments. This development may escalate tensions in the region, as Iran could perceive such actions as a direct threat to its interests. PROJECTED VECTORS: Increased military presence and operations in the Strait of Hormuz may provoke Iranian responses, potentially leading to heightened conflict.
